What Is Digital Procurement?

Digital procurement refers to the usage of digital applied sciences to automate, combine, and optimize procurement processes inside sourcing, buying, provider administration, and spend evaluation.

It replaces paper-based work cycles, disconnected instruments, and handbook approvals with centralized platforms, reside knowledge, and automatic help.

Nevertheless, you will need to make clear that digitalization just isn’t about gathering purposes or implementing software program techniques for their very own sake.

It’s about utilizing tech to free procurement specialists, in order that they will concentrate on areas the place human judgment nonetheless stays important: understanding the nuances of the provider market, analyzing the scope of initiatives, advising on dangers, and coordinating supplier-related choices.

Why Digital Procurement Issues: Key Enterprise Advantages

  • Value Optimization and Spend Visibility: Value optimization and full spend visibility are among the many most direct advantages. E-procurement platforms convey spend knowledge from suppliers, classes, enterprise items, and areas right into a single view, serving to detect off-contract spending, regulate provider agreements, and measure achieved financial savings.
  • Sooner Procurement Cycles: One other main benefit is that procurement sequences could be carried out at a a lot faster tempo. Automation replaces handbook steps and fragmented approvals, supporting quicker processing of requests, faster provider responses, and higher matching with enterprise wants.
  • Higher Provider Engagement By way of Strategic Sourcing: Digital procurement additionally strengthens provider engagement. Centralized portals create a single normal for registration, doc alternate, efficiency monitoring, and communication. This fashion, suppliers get a clearer sense of expectations, deadlines, and compliance necessities.
  • Threat Mitigation and Compliance: Equally vital is threat mitigation and regulatory adherence. Digital techniques assist observe contracts, certifications, service-level agreements, and regulatory necessities throughout the provider base, in addition to flag contract expirations, gaps, or efficiency issues earlier than they escalate into extreme dangers.
  • Information-Pushed Selections: Lastly, digital instruments assist procurement groups use knowledge, not guesswork, to make choices. Analytics remodel uncooked knowledge into insights that information technique and every day operations.

Elements of Profitable Digital Procurement Transformation

In accordance with Statista, the time, effort, and sources an organization already spends on procurement get higher outcomes when the method is digitalized. However what precisely constitutes profitable digitalization?

Strategic Goals

Digital procurement ought to all the time start with specific targets. Know-how is a instrument to realize enterprise outcomes, not the opposite method round. Firms have to resolve what they wish to enhance — be it chopping prices, lowering dangers, rushing up procurement cycles, or strengthening provider partnerships.

For instance, an organization with excessive maverick spend may concentrate on centralizing purchases, whereas one other combating provider delays may intention to hurry up approvals.

On the identical time, strategic priorities usually rely on the {industry}. Healthcare procurement transformation often focuses on strict compliance and provider documentation management.

Telecom procurement transformation and excessive tech procurement transformation are usually pushed by the necessity for quicker sourcing. In manufacturing, OEM procurement transformation is commonly centered round provide chain stability, supply timelines, and avoiding manufacturing disruptions.

General, figuring out your gaps and targets first helps direct which instruments and processes to cowl.

A Clear Procurement Transformation Roadmap

Don’t attempt to digitalize every little thing directly; it may be complicated and positively costly. Analysis reveals that giant expertise initiatives usually harshly exceed their budgets or timelines when approached as one giant motion.

Digital Procurement Transformation

In a examine of 1,471 IT initiatives, the typical value overrun was round 27%, and about one in six skilled excessive overruns (≈200%+).

As an alternative, it’s vital to create a roadmap that embraces essentially the most precious processes first. For instance, begin with automating buy orders or bill approvals to see fast outcomes.

Early wins present the advantages to executives and stakeholders, making it simpler to develop digitalization to extra advanced areas later, akin to contract administration or provider threat evaluation.

Change Administration and Coaching

Digital procurement usually implies new methods of working. Groups want coaching, steerage, and management help to make use of the instruments to their most.

For instance, if managers get a report on provider efficiency however aren’t educated to know it, the instrument received’t assist them make higher choices. Supporting groups by way of the change ensures the expertise really brings worth.

Standardized Processes Earlier than Automating

Automation hurries up processes, however it could possibly additionally amplify inefficiencies. Earlier than introducing expertise, be sure that workflows are systematized and coordinated.

For instance, if completely different departments use completely different approval paths for buy requests, automating these workflows with out standardization might create dysfunction and errors.

Governance and Observe Metrics

Clear possession and measurable KPIs are vital to long-term success. Firms have to know who’s accountable for what and observe efficiency to make sure the brand new processes are working.

Helpful metrics embody how lengthy buy orders take, how a lot spend is off-contract, provider efficiency, and value financial savings achieved by way of digital initiatives. Watching these indicators helps decide issues and enhance procurement.

Implementing Digital Procurement: A Step-by-Step Information

Any initiative involving organizational change can look like a frightening job, but it surely doesn’t should be. By creating a step-by-step plan, you possibly can put together for any sudden obstacles.

Step 1: Assess Your Present Procurement Maturity

Earlier than you put money into new expertise, it’s vital to know the place you’re in the present day.

Many corporations (although removed from true maturity) aren’t ranging from zero — primary digital instruments like e-procurement or spend analytics might already be in place.

A structured evaluation can reveal vital gaps, as an example, an organization may have already got an e-procurement system however nonetheless rely on handbook approvals, or have good spend knowledge however no analytics instruments to make sense of it.

With out a clear image of your present maturity:

  • You may implement expertise that doesn’t remedy your actual issues.
  • You threat repeating handbook work in a brand new system.
  • Chances are you’ll undervalue coaching wants or integration complexity.

Step 2: Specify Enterprise and Procurement Necessities

After you perceive the present state of your procurement operate, the following step is to show enterprise goals into tangible procurement necessities. Saying “we’d like quicker cycle occasions” is simply too imprecise. What does quicker actually imply to your group? What particular outcomes are you anticipating?

The aim right here is to show broad enterprise outcomes into clear, measurable situations that expertise and course of adjustments should help. A particularly outlined aim may appear to be this: “Approvals have to be accomplished inside 24 hours and routinely routed primarily based on spend stage.”

Step 3: Choose the Proper Digital Procurement Applied sciences

Selecting digital procurement applied sciences ought to begin with enterprise actuality, not vendor guarantees or trend-driven choices.

Earlier than particular instruments, an organization wants a transparent understanding of its procurement complexity, transaction volumes, regulatory necessities, and the way procurement matches into the broader enterprise framework.

One of many first choices is whether or not to depend on a single end-to-end procurement platform or a mixture of specialised instruments.

A number of specialised instruments provide performance in particular areas, akin to sourcing, provider threat administration, or superior spend analytics, but it surely additionally will increase integration complexity and locations larger calls for on knowledge governance and IT help.

Unified platforms usually cowl all the source-to-pay cycle, providing centralized knowledge and less complicated governance. They’re usually a greater match for organizations looking for quicker implementation, predictable prices, and simpler person adoption.

Nevertheless, such platforms could be limiting for corporations with advanced procurement fashions, industry-specific necessities, or superior analytics wants, the place sure modules might lack depth.

In follow, many enterprises undertake a hybrid strategy, utilizing a core procurement platform as a basis and lengthening it with specialised instruments the place differentiation issues most.

One other selection is between market-ready options and custom-made procurement techniques. Off-the-shelf platforms present confirmed performance, quicker deployment, and common vendor updates, making them appropriate for organizations with normal procurement processes or restricted inner improvement capability.

Customized options, akin to these made by SCAND, then again, are justified when procurement processes are deeply tied to uncommon enterprise fashions, strict compliance necessities, or legacy environments that normal platforms can not help.

Customized improvement permits organizations to rearrange work sequences, knowledge fashions, and integrations exactly round their wants, but it surely requires larger upfront funding, longer implementation timelines, and common upkeep.

Step 4: Put together Information and Integrations

Digital procurement solely works effectively when the information is correct and techniques correctly join.

Even the perfect procurement administration platform is not going to yield outcomes if provider info is outdated, product classes are inconsistent, and spending knowledge is scattered throughout completely different instruments and spreadsheets.

For instance, one division might listing a provider as “IBM,” whereas one other makes use of “IBM Corp.” If the information isn’t cleaned, it turns into troublesome to see complete spending or observe provider efficiency appropriately.

As for integrations, they need to be deliberate from the very starting. Procurement doesn’t work individually from the remainder of the enterprise.

Usually, procurement instruments ought to combine with:

  • ERP techniques (budgets, grasp knowledge, buy orders)
  • Finance techniques (invoices, funds, approvals)
  • Stock instruments (inventory ranges, reorders)
  • Provide chain techniques (supply monitoring, provider efficiency)
  • PIM techniques (centralized product info, attributes, and catalog administration)

With out integration, groups should should enter the identical knowledge manually, resulting in delays and the danger of errors.

Step 5: Pilot and Validate Key Use Instances

As an alternative of launching all the digital procurement system directly, corporations ought to start with a number of pilot initiatives.

A pilot is a managed rollout centered on one or two processes that may produce fast outcomes. Typical pilot areas embody buy approvals, spend monitoring, provider onboarding, or bill matching.

Beginning small permits groups to check how the answer works in actual situations, verify whether or not it has worth, and repair issues with out disrupting the entire group.

For instance, an organization may first automate buy requests for one division. If it reduces approval time and improves management, the identical strategy can then be expanded throughout the enterprise.

Pilots additionally make it simpler to show ROI and get buy-in from stakeholders earlier than investing in a full rollout.

Step 6: Present Customers with the Crucial Capabilities

Even the perfect procurement platform is ineffective if staff don’t use it. That’s why adoption is without doubt one of the most vital components of digital transformation.

Firms want to offer coaching, clear directions, and help. Staff ought to perceive not solely how the system works, but additionally why it issues and the way it helps them do their job quicker and with fewer errors.

For instance, if managers see that approvals take much less time and require fewer emails, they’re much extra prone to help the brand new course of as a substitute of avoiding it.

Step 7: Monitor and Refine Efficiency

The digitalization of procurement just isn’t a one-time challenge. After implementation, corporations should observe the outcomes and enhance the method over time.

This implies monitoring key efficiency indicators akin to request approval pace, procurement cycle time, compliance ranges, value financial savings, and provider efficiency. Common opinions assist establish what’s working effectively and the place delays or inefficiencies nonetheless exist.

Challenges and Limitations to Profitable Transformation

Digital procurement transformation can fail even when corporations put money into good platforms and fashionable instruments. The most typical issues usually are not technical; they’re strategic and administrative. Beneath are the primary pitfalls enterprises ought to pay attention to.

  • Shopping for expertise earlier than recognizing issues. When organizations buy a platform with out clear use instances, the result’s usually costly “shelfware” that groups don’t use. This additionally creates frustration and resistance, as a result of staff really feel pressured to undertake instruments that don’t remedy their day-to-day points.
  • Following a one-size-fits-all course. Not each exercise needs to be automated to the identical diploma. Approvals, bill matching, or catalog purchases could be automated nearly absolutely. Nevertheless, strategic sourcing, provider negotiations, and threat administration usually require knowledgeable involvement and robust relationships. Profitable transformation means understanding which processes needs to be digital-first and which ought to stay human-led.
  • Set-and-forget mindset. Procurement administration instruments require monitoring, updates, and optimization. With out correct administration, workflows turn into outdated, integrations break down, and person adoption declines. Over time, corporations might discover themselves paying for platforms that now not present tangible advantages.
